Parse er en backend-tjeneste laget av Facebook. Backend-tjenester bruker skylagring sammen med spesielle tjenester, vanligvis integrering med sosiale nettverk og pushvarsler for ulike plattformer. Parse, spesielt, brukes som backend for mobile enheter.

Dessverre blir Parse stengt. Siden 28. januar 2016 har Parse slått ned sin tjeneste, og en gang 28. januar 2017 kommer sammen, den vil bli stengt helt.

I denne artikkelen vil vi gå over våre anbefalte Parse-alternativer og erstatninger, og hva du kan gjøre fremover som en apputvikler.

6. Parse Server

Hvis du ikke er klar til å fortsette, er Parse ikke helt død. Snarere er den åpen og er kjent som Parse Server. Overgangsmessig, dette bør være lettest siden det er det meste det samme systemet. Det vil imidlertid kreve at du administrerer din egen server og Mongo database, noe som kan være vanskelig hvis du skulle kreve Parse å gjøre alt arbeidet tidligere.

I tillegg er denne tjenesten åpen kildekode, i motsetning til de andre alternativene i denne listen. Dette betyr at lenge siden januar 2017, vil det fortsette å bli holdt opp og forbedret av samfunnet.

5. Backendless

Backendless er både en hosting service og en app utvikling plattform. Siden nyheten om Facebook Parse kom ut, har Backendless markedsført seg som Premiere Parse-erstatning, med en av de viktigste fordelene som at den er gratis.

Hvis du allerede er en Parse-utvikler og ønsker å spare penger, kan du sjekke ut Backendless 'Migreringsveiledning. Det er ganske grundig og bør hjelpe deg underveis.

4. Built.io Backend

Built.io Backend er en tjeneste som fokuserer på å muliggjøre etablering av raske applikasjoner. Den primære fordelen med Built.io er fokus på å administrere sky servere og skalering, samtidig som devs bare kan fokusere på brukeropplevelsen.

Dette er i tillegg til de ekstra funksjonene i integrering av sosiale nettverk, geografisk plassering og sky-utvidelser.

3. moBack

moBack er både en cloud backend og app utvikling studio. Den kan distribueres på eksisterende AWS (Amazon Web Services) infrastruktur eller en lokal datasentral infrastruktur. Det er også en "fri" plattform, noe som betyr at du er mer enn velkommen til å prøve det selv før du tar det fulle.

Funksjoner som tilbys av moBack, inkluderer analysetjenester, datastyringstjenester (via REST API) og andre kjernebackend-tjenester, for eksempel push notifications.

2. AnyPresence

AnyPresence er en bedriftsløsning, fokusert på å håndtere store bedrifter. De distribuerer på både skyen og på stedet, og ble først og fremst grunnlagt av tidligere Oracle og Cisco-ledere.

AnyPresence har et spesielt fokus på sterk kundesupport og høyt nivå utvikler og bedriftsfunksjoner. Hvis du er en stor bedrift, kan AnyPresence være den du leter etter; mindre bedrifter vil kanskje se andre steder.

1. Firebase

Firebase er en sterk, Google-drevet backend-tjeneste. I motsetning til andre oppføringer i denne listen, er Firebase helt gjennomsiktig om prismodellen, men det er i utgangspunktet gratis for de minste distribusjonene.

På grunn av å være drevet av Google, har Firebase noen av de kraftigste serverne bak den for din bruk. Når det er sagt, er de andre leverandørene på denne listen også ganske pålitelige i seg selv, som vanligvis støttes av Amazon.

Som en ulempe har Firebase for øyeblikket ingen enkel sti fra Parse, noe som gjør det mer et alternativ enn en erstatning.

Konklusjon

Firebase tjener sine poeng fra meg basert på støtten og gjennomsiktigheten. Når det er sagt, AnyPresence kan være bedre for større bedrifter, legger moBack app-utvikling inn i mixen. Built.io tilbyr ulike tjenester av seg selv, og Backendless ser ut til å sømløst hjelpe deg med overgangen fra Parse til en ny backend.

Som de fleste ting i livet, det du bruker i stedet for Parse, er egentlig et spørsmål om personlig preferanse. Mine høyeste anbefalinger er Firebase (hvis du ikke allerede bruker Parse) og Backendless (hvis du gjør det).